Some interesting news here for those who are still active playing Tiberium Alliances. It would appear that the long running browser based Command & Conquer is seeing a change of developer. Envision Entertainment, made up of many of the team who were at Phenomic, the original developer of Tiberium Alliances, will be taking control and guiding it into the future. This is announcement made on the Official Tiberium Alliances Forums.

 

Friends and Commanders,

We are proud to serve such a dedicated community, and are excited to write today with news of the next chapter in the life and history of Tiberium Alliances.

Command & Conquer Tiberium Alliances is a fantastic game and it´s hard to find something like it out there. Over the past few years, the game has seen some great progression and features added to the game, but in recent weeks, while talking to our player community, we see many things that we could change and improve. In recent times, we just haven't had the ability to fulfill and realize all of our and your ideas, but the good news is we’ve found a helping hand.

We are happy to announce that, starting today, Envision Entertainment will partner with Electronic Arts to develop, support and conduct live operations for Command & Conquer Tiberium Alliances on EA’s behalf. Who are these guys, you ask? Envision Entertainment is a studio founded in 2013 with the original creators of Command & Conquer Tiberium Alliances forming the core of the team. So who else would be more suitable to develop the game further than them?

Electronic Arts will continue to provide billing and account services through its Origin™ service. Envision Entertainment and Electronic Arts will work closely together to ensure a bright future for the game.
